Join OnePay, a consumer financial services app, as a Project Manager on the Product Operations team. You will lead the execution of important projects, delivering new features to customers and improving their financial lives. Collaborate with cross-functional stakeholders (Product, Design, Engineering, Marketing, and Operations) on new product features and internal processes. This role involves supporting product roadmap governance, delivering product launch plans, managing project management tools, creating efficient processes, communicating with external partners, and managing banking relationships. The ideal candidate has 5+ years of relevant experience in technology-based project management, a passion for collaboration tools, experience in financial services, and strong communication and leadership skills. OnePay offers competitive benefits, including base salary, stock options, health benefits, 401(k) plan, remote work flexibility, and opportunities for growth.
